For Petitioners : Mr.M.Vigneshkumar For R-1 : Mr.A.P.G.Ohm Chairma Prabhu Government Advocate (Crl.side) For R-2 : Mr.D.Balamurugapandi COMMON ORDER These Criminal Original petitions in Crl.OP(MD)Nos.2099 and 2114 of 2018 have been filed to quash the First Information Reports in Crime Nos.379 and 377 of 2017 on the file of the first respondent police, as against the petitioners.
2.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ioners and the learned Government Advocate (Crl.side) appearing for the first respondent and the learned counsel appearing for the second respondent.
3.The petitioner in Crl.OP(MD)No.2099 of 2018 is the sole accused in Crime No.379 of 2017 and similarly the petitioners in Crl.OP(MD)No.2114 of 2018 are the accused Nos.1 to 3 in Crime No.377 of 2017. The first petitioner in Crl.OP(MD) No.2114 of 2018 is the de-facto complainant in Crl.OP(MD)No.2099 of 2018 and similarly the petitioner in Crl.OP(MD)No.2099 of 2018 is the de-facto complainant in Crl.OP(MD) No.2114 of 2018.
4.The complaint in Crime No.379 of 2017 was registered for the offences punishable under Sections 294(b) and 323 IPC, on the file of the first respondent police. Similarly, the complaint in Crime No.377 of 2017 was registered for the offences punishable under Sections 294(b), 323, 324 and 506(ii) IPC, on the file of the first respondent police.
5.It appears that at the advise of the elders and friends, the petitioners and second respondent in both the cases have agreed to compromise the matter, out of Court. A Joint Compromise Memos, dated 07.02.2018, are also filed to that effect. As per the Joint Compromise Memos, the de-facto complainant, namely, the second respondent, in both cases, have given their consent to quash the First Information Reports in Crime Nos.379 and 377 of 2017. 6.The parties appeared before this Court and expressed in unequivocal terms that they have signed in the Joint Compromise
Memos on their own will and volition. The identities of the parties are verified with reference to the authenticated documents produced by the parties before this Court. The identities of the parties are also confirmed by the learned Government Advocate through the first respondent police.
7.Having regard to the agreement made between the parties, this Court is of the view that no useful purpose will be served by keeping these matters pending. As per the Compromise Memos signed by the parties, the de-facto complainant, namely, the second respondent in both cases have agreed to quash the First Information Reports in Crime Nos.379 and 377 of 2017. Hence the First Information Reports in Crime Nos.379 and 377 of 2017, on the file of the first respondent, namely, the Inspector of Police, Vadamadurai Police Station, Dindigul District, are quashed in toto and the Joint Compromise Memos signed by the parties shall form part of the order.
8. Accordingly, these Criminal Original petitions are allowed. Sd/- Assistant Registrar(CO) /True Copy/ Sub Assistant Registrar Encl:Xerox copy of Compromise Memos To
